public Server(int Port, string IP)
 {
     this.Host  = IP;
     this.Port  = Port;
     iPEndPoint = new IPEndPoint(IPAddress.Parse(Host), Port);
     logger     = new LogProgram(ref database);
     worker     = new Worker(ref database, ref logger);
     Console.WriteLine("Server run./ Host:port = " + Host + ":" + Port);
     logger.WriteLog("Server run. Host:port = " + Host + ":" + Port, LogLevel.Server);
 }
 public Worker(ref Database callDB, ref LogProgram logprogram)
 {
     this.database    = callDB;
     this.logger      = logprogram;
     this.mail        = new MailF(database, logger);
     this.tasker      = new TaskManager(logger);
     this.loaderFile  = new LoaderFile(ref database, ref logger);
     this.excelModule = new ExcelModule(ref database, ref logger, ref loaderFile);
     tasker.EmailMonitoring(this);
 }
 public ExcelModule(ref Database Database, ref LogProgram logProgram, ref LoaderFile loaderFile)
 {
     this.database   = Database;
     this.logger     = logProgram;
     this.loaderFile = loaderFile;
 }
Example #4
0
        public static void LaunchReadOnly()
        {
            LogProgram log = new LogProgram();

            log.ReadConsoleLogsDatabase();
        }